Navjot Singh Sidhu likely to release from Patiala jail on Saturday, April 1

Congress leader Navjot Singh Sidhu could be released from Patiala Jail on Saturday, as per a tweet from Sidhu’s Twitter handle. However, the Punjab Government has not confirmed this news yet. Meetings are currently underway for the release of the prisoners. Meanwhile, Sidhu has shared this information based on the details provided by the concerned authority. It’s worth noting that Sidhu has been lodged in Patiala Jail since May 20, 2022, after being sentenced to one year in the 1990 road rage case.

48 days of sentence remaining

Sidhu was sentenced to one year on May 19, 2022. As per jail rules, prisoners are given four days’ leave every month. During his sentence, Sidhu did not take a single day off, which means his sentence will end 48 days earlier than expected, on March 31.

Republic Day release was also expected

Earlier, there were reports that Sidhu could be released on Republic Day i.e. January 26. It was speculated that he could be one of the 50 prisoners given special exemption on Republic Day. However, this did not happen, and Sidhu’s supporters had to return with their banners and hoardings at the last moment.

Big name in Punjab politics

Sidhu is a prominent figure in Punjab politics and is always in the headlines. Sidhu, who began his political career with the BJP, is also playing a significant role in Congress. After leaving the BJP and joining Congress, Sidhu has become an essential figure in Punjab politics. He has made himself politically strong, which sets him apart from other leaders. This is why the BJP fielded him in the Lok Sabha elections thrice. Sidhu’s political power remained intact even after joining Congress, and the party supported him despite the opposition of its strong leader, Captain Amarinder Singh.
